**_Stevenage_** **MBDA Missile Systems - Together. For the Future of Defence.** **Programmes Graduate** Throughout the life cycle of our products, it takes a range of people and skills to design and craft and deliver what we do for our end customer. One of the most integral roles comes from our Project Management office. Project Management, Project Control and our Agile teams work simultaneously with each other to deliver programmes of work and projects to customers and end users on time, within budget and to the agreed specification. Working with partners throughout our organisation in a fast paced exciting and changing environment, you will be at the very centre of the project - Collating updates and information from all areas of the business - at all levels - to plan what to do next on a given project. **What's the opportunity?** Our **Project Managers** work with metrics to identify and implement improvements in existing metrics as well as look at ways to improve the existing process for project planning. You will Identify and locate project kit at a number of UK sites, travelling to the physical locations where necessary as well as identify and then prepare a "how to" guide on the documentation suite required for contracts. This varied role will involve updating project plans, preparing costs for work with engineers to be presented to senior management and updating Risk Registers. Our **Project Control** teams look at projects from assessment phases to those in manufacturing and development; you'll get a full insight to all the different stages of the missile lifecycle. In this team, you'll build a strong network across the business right from the beginning working with the Business team. This will include Project Managers and our Commercial team as well as Manufacturing, Technical and Engineering teams so you'll learn a great deal of all aspects of our business and our products. There is the opportunity to work with the Ministry of Defence and some of our Customers as well. Our **Agile** teams adopt an iterative approach to delivering our projects; working in sprints and utilising Agile Software technology. Using Scrum Master Techniques, you'll be working with other teams and the customer to arrive at adaptive solutions for complex problems. We have graduate positions available in Project Control, Project Management and Agile - through our assessment process we will evaluate your behaviours, knowledge, skills and experience to determine the best scheme for you Whichever project path you take, our collaborative approach and culture of sharing knowledge will be key to your development.
